On June 2, the Xinjiang Department of Ecology and Environment, in accordance with the relevant regulations regarding the approval process for environmental impact assessments of construction projects, accepted the environmental impact assessment documents for the “100,000 tons per year high-carbon alcohol project” of Itai Yili Energy Co., Ltd., the “100,000 tons per year FTO wax project” of the same company, and the “260,000 tons per year alkylbenzene project” of Itai Yili Energy Co., Ltd., and made these documents public. Basic overview of the three proposed projects: Project name: Yitai Ili Energy Co., Ltd. 100,000 tons/year high-carbon alcohol project. Developer: Yitai Ili Energy Co., Ltd. Nature of the project: New construction. Location: The Yitai Ili Industrial Park is situated in the southern part of Chabuchar County, with a planned area of 9.77 km2. This project is located on the south side of the planned park, and the land is designated for industrial use. The east side of the site is open space; the west side houses the 100,000 tons per year Fischer-Tropsch wax project and the 260,000 tons per year alkylbenzene project. The north side features the belt conveyor system for coal transfer within the coal-to-oil project area, while the south side is also open space. The area covered by this project is approximately 184,000 m2. Project investment: The total estimated investment for this project is 930.648 million yuan. This project uses naphtha subjected to low-temperature oil washing, hydrogenated light oils rich in α-olefins, and crude light hydrocarbons derived from alkylbenzenes as raw materials to produce LPG, n-hexanol, n-heptanol, n-octanol, n-nonanol, n-decanol, isocarbonic dodecanol, isocarbonic tetradecanol, isocarbonic hexadecanol, isocarbonic octadecanol, and isocarbonic eicosanol. The production capacity is 100,000 tons per year. The construction scope of this project includes the establishment of a 100,000-ton/year high-carbon alcohol production facility; the addition of 1 35/10.5 kV substation and 2 10/0.4 kV substations as part of the power supply system; the construction of a fourth circulating water plant to serve the fine chemicals production process; and the liquid storage and transportation infrastructure, which includes newly added intermediate tank areas, finished product tank areas, and loading systems. Project Name: Itai Ili Energy Co., Ltd. 100,000 tons/year FTO wax project. Constructor: Itai Ili Energy Co., Ltd. Nature of construction: New construction. Location: The project is to be built in the Itai Ili Industrial Park, located in the southern part of Chabuchar County. The planned area of the park is 9.77 km2, and the park has an irregular polygonal shape. This project is located on the southwest side of the planned park, and its land use is designated for industrial purposes. To the east of the proposed project is a 100,000-ton/year high-carbon alcohol facility; to the west is the flare system planned for the entire industrial park; to the north is an 260,000-ton/year alkylbenzene plant; and to the south of the fire station planned for the park is open space. The site area of this project is approximately 92,400 m2. Project investment: The total estimated investment for this project is 238.77 million yuan. This project uses reduced paraffin oil from the hydrogenation refining unit of the oil processing plant in Yitai Ili Energy Co., Ltd.’s 1 million tons per year coal-to-oil demonstration project as raw material, and employs short-path distillation technology provided by a patent holder to produce various grades of FTO wax products, including 85# FTO wax, 90# FTO wax, 95# FTO wax, 100# FTO wax, and 105# FTO wax, with an annual production capacity of 100,000 tons (based on the raw material). Project Name: Itai Ili Energy Co., Ltd. 260,000 tons/year Alkylbenzene ProjectOwner of the Project: Itai Ili Energy Co., Ltd.
Construction Location: Itai Ili Industrial Park, Chabuchar County
Nature of the Project: New construction
Project Investment: The total investment for this project is 569.74 million yuan. This project uses the intermediate products C10–C17 olefins and aromatics (benzene) from coal-to-oil demonstration projects as primary raw materials to produce surfactants. Based on the raw material supply capacity of the coal-to-oil demonstration project, as well as an analysis of the construction party’s technical capabilities, financial situation, staffing levels, and the market share for the products, the production scale has been determined as follows: The main product of this project is linear surfactants, with an output of 12.01×104 tons per year. Additionally, by-product outputs include 5.61×104 tons per year of heavy surfactants, 4.33×104 tons per year of light alkanes, 6.89×104 tons per year of heavy alkanes, 1.67×104 tons per year of solvent oil, 148 tons per year of fusel oils, 24.84 tons per year of tar, and a small amount of sodium fluoride. The design flexibility of the production facility is 70%–120%. The main components of the project are the surfactant production facilities, which include purification and separation processes, reaction processes, and neutralization processes ; The plant’s utility and auxiliary facilities include tank farms, circulating water stations, heat transfer oil systems, loading/unloading platforms, laboratory buildings, etc ; The plant’s water supply, nitrogen, steam, compressed air, flare systems, wastewater treatment facilities, etc., are all based on Yitai Ili Energy Co., Ltd.’s 1 million tons per year coal-to-oil demonstration project; the circulating cooling water system and power supply rely on the fourth circulating water system of the high-carbon alcohol project and a 35KV substation. It is reported that in September 2014, Yitai Ili Energy Co., Ltd. constructed a coal-to-oil demonstration project with an annual capacity of 1 million tons in Chabuchar County, Ili Kazakh Autonomous Prefecture, Xinjiang Uygur Autonomous Region. The project owner commissioned China National Petroleum Corporation Northeast Refining & Chemical Engineering Co., Ltd. to prepare the \"Environmental Impact Assessment Report for Yitai Yili Energy Co., Ltd.’s 1 million tons per year coal-to-oil demonstration project\" ; In October 2014, the Department of Ecology and Environment of the Xinjiang Uyghur Autonomous Region issued the \"Preliminary Opinions on the Environmental Impact Assessment Report for Yitai Yili Energy Co., Ltd.’s 1 million tons per year coal-to-oil demonstration project\" (Document No. Xin Huan Zi [2014] 422) ; In March 2015, the Department of Ecology and Environment of the Xinjiang Uyghur Autonomous Region issued the \"Preliminary Opinions on the Total Emission Limits for Major Pollutants for the 1 million tons per year coal-to-oil demonstration project of Yitai Yili Energy Co., Ltd.\" (Document No. Xin Huan Zi [2015] 113) ; In September 2017, it received the approval from the Ministry of Ecology and Environment of the People’s Republic of China regarding the Environmental Impact Assessment Report for Yitai Yili Energy Co., Ltd.’s 1 million tons per year coal-to-oil demonstration project (Document No. Huan Shen [2017] 151). The 1 million tons per year coal-to-oil demonstration project of Yitai Ili Energy Co., Ltd. is being constructed by Yitai Ili Energy Co., Ltd. Itai Yili Energy Co., Ltd. was established in September 2009. It is a joint-stock enterprise formed by Inner Mongolia Itai Group Co., Ltd. and its core subsidiary, Inner Mongolia Itai Coal Co., Ltd.; the company’s registered capital amounts to 1.57 billion RMB. Among them, Inner Mongolia Yitai Group Co., Ltd. holds a 9.2% stake, while Inner Mongolia Yitai Coal Co., Ltd. holds a 90.8% stake. Progress of the current project construction: 1) Construction of the current project began in June 2011, and site grading was completed in July 2013. 2) The civil structure work for the plant site began in July 2014; the works completed to date include: ① the frame of the air separation unit’s air coolers, the foundations for the compressors, the foundations for the cryogenic tanks, and the foundation for the air separation pump room. ②Gasification unit: 6 layers of concrete gasification framework; slag treatment: 1–2 layers of framework; foundations and 1 layer of framework for the coal grinding plant and the feeding plant. ③Some of the framework for the purification unit and the tower foundation. ④Synthesis unit: frames for layers 1 to 3 of the synthesis plant, as well as pipe galleries and equipment foundations for the decarburization unit. ⑤Some of the foundation frames for oil processing and liquid storage and transportation facilities, as well as the tank foundations in the intermediate tank area and the finished product tank area. ⑥Concrete pouring for the retaining wall of the 9.8-meter circular coal storage bin in the solid material storage and transportation facility, as well as concrete pouring in the coal crusher room from -7.0 meters to -3.8 meters. ⑦The thermal power unit for the boilers is located on the first 3 floors of the main boiler building; the steel frames for the three boilers have been installed, the construction of the chimneys is complete, and the coal transfer corridor has been raised above ground level. 3) In terms of equipment installation, to date, the existing project has completed the lifting of the following equipment: 5 gasification furnaces, 2 Fischer-Tropsch synthesis reactors, and the steam drums of Boilers No. 1 and No. 2. 4) Water supply and drainage system: The primary water supply and drainage network for the entire plant, as well as the main structure of the production fire water tanks, have been completed. 5) The area in front of the factory and the warehouse area have been completed. Problems and Countermeasures: During the construction of the underground sewage pipes, the \"Code for Seepage Control in Petrochemical Projects\" (GB/T50934-2013) had not yet been issued and implemented. The material used for these pipes was spiral-welded submerged-arc welded steel pipes with internal and external anti-corrosion coatings, which did not comply with the requirement specified in clause (5.5.1) of the said code, which states that \"for underground sewage pipes with a diameter of DN≤500 millimeters, seamless steel pipes should be used; for pipes with a diameter greater than 500 mm, straight-seam welded steel pipes are preferred.\" Once construction resumes, the following remedial measures will be taken: pollution-control rainwater collection tanks will be installed at each facility to collect water from floor washing and initial rainfall, which will then be pumped up to the pipe gallery and sent to a wastewater treatment plant for processing. Polluted rainwater from various devices is no longer discharged into underground pipes. Penalties for construction without approval: With regard to the environmental violations related to the construction of existing projects without prior approval, the Environmental Protection Department of the autonomous region, in accordance with Article 22, Paragraph 2, and Article 31, Paragraph 1 of the Environmental Impact Assessment Law of the People’s Republic of China, issued the following penalty decisions: 1) On November 3, 2014, it issued Decision No. Xin Huan Gai Zi 1-047, ordering the enterprise to cease construction until it obtained the approval documents for the environmental impact assessment. 2) On April 3, 2015, Decision No. 1-008 on Administrative Penalties was issued, imposing a fine of 200,000 yuan and ordering the suspension of construction until approval documents for environmental impact assessment were obtained. Itai Yili Energy Co., Ltd. ceased construction on November 3, 2014, and paid the required fines.
